Question 1157856: 1. Suppose a brewery has a filling machine that fills 12 ounce bottles of beer. It is known that the amount of beer poured by this filling machine follows a normal distribution with a mean of 12.27 ounces and a standard deviation of 0.06 ounce. Find the probability that the bottle contains between 12.17 and 12.23 ounces Answer by Boreal(15235) (Show Source):
You can put this solution on YOUR website! z=(x-mean)/sd
(12.17-12.27)/.06 =-1.67
(12.23-12.27)/.06=-0.67
we want the probability between those two values of z.
Can use the table or a calculator
probability is 0.2040.
